另外一种升级方法(openBSD)
发表于 : 2011-05-30 18:37
每半年,升一次级,每次都要刻盘,都烦了,现在发现一个另外升级的方法,超简单,可能大家都知道,但是总有不知道的不是,我就粗粗的说说吧。
1.从 网站下来 bsd。rd,复制到/目录下
2.从网站下来installX。iso,解压缩到你的备份目录下,比如 /home/wkx9dragon/backup/
3.开机重启,在黑屏等待是,选择 bsd。rd 内核,进入安装程序。
4.在安装程序中,install,ugrade, 选择u跟新。
5.出现强制挂载openbsd分区,选者同意。
6.出现选则安装介质,选择 Disk
7.出现选择安装文件是否已经挂载,选择是[如果你的解压缩的安装文件,和openbsd是一个硬盘,否者自己ctrl+C,挂载后,在从2开始]
8.默认目录比如pub/openbsd/amd64,要修改为自己的文件放置位置,其实就是加一个/mnt/,因为安装程序自动把你原来的/分区挂载/mnt/下了。
9.安装程序让你选择压缩包(bsd,bsd。rd。bsd.mp,baseX。tgz,等等)和正常安装一样。
10.装完了,重启。[呵呵,没结束呢。]
11.重启后,你会发现,出现“ sshdCould not load host key: /etc/ssh/ssh_host_ecdsa_key”,这时候,用root 权限执行一下命令。
[转载]http://www.gobsd.org/showthread.php?p=5320#post5320
# ssh-keygen -t rsa1 -f /etc/ssh/ssh_host_key -N ""
# ssh-keygen -t dsa -f /etc/ssh/ssh_host_dsa_key -N ""
# ssh-keygen -t rsa -f /etc/ssh/ssh_host_rsa_key -N ""
# ssh-keygen -t ecdsa -f /etc/ssh/ssh_host_ecdsa_key -N "" [这个很是让我迷惑,我的电脑里,根本没有这个文件(/etc/ssh/ssh_host_ecdsa),可是没有这条命令根本不行],如果过有错误,就是记错了,但是这四个文件我肯定不是都有的。
1.从 网站下来 bsd。rd,复制到/目录下
2.从网站下来installX。iso,解压缩到你的备份目录下,比如 /home/wkx9dragon/backup/
3.开机重启,在黑屏等待是,选择 bsd。rd 内核,进入安装程序。
4.在安装程序中,install,ugrade, 选择u跟新。
5.出现强制挂载openbsd分区,选者同意。
6.出现选则安装介质,选择 Disk
7.出现选择安装文件是否已经挂载,选择是[如果你的解压缩的安装文件,和openbsd是一个硬盘,否者自己ctrl+C,挂载后,在从2开始]
8.默认目录比如pub/openbsd/amd64,要修改为自己的文件放置位置,其实就是加一个/mnt/,因为安装程序自动把你原来的/分区挂载/mnt/下了。
9.安装程序让你选择压缩包(bsd,bsd。rd。bsd.mp,baseX。tgz,等等)和正常安装一样。
10.装完了,重启。[呵呵,没结束呢。]
11.重启后,你会发现,出现“ sshdCould not load host key: /etc/ssh/ssh_host_ecdsa_key”,这时候,用root 权限执行一下命令。
[转载]http://www.gobsd.org/showthread.php?p=5320#post5320
# ssh-keygen -t rsa1 -f /etc/ssh/ssh_host_key -N ""
# ssh-keygen -t dsa -f /etc/ssh/ssh_host_dsa_key -N ""
# ssh-keygen -t rsa -f /etc/ssh/ssh_host_rsa_key -N ""
# ssh-keygen -t ecdsa -f /etc/ssh/ssh_host_ecdsa_key -N "" [这个很是让我迷惑,我的电脑里,根本没有这个文件(/etc/ssh/ssh_host_ecdsa),可是没有这条命令根本不行],如果过有错误,就是记错了,但是这四个文件我肯定不是都有的。